Avnish Kumar is a researcher in computer vision and machine learning, with a primary focus on robust visual tracking and occlusion handling. His most-cited work, "Robust Visual Tracking with Occlusion Handling Using Gaussian Mixture Modeling" (2021), introduces a novel approach to maintaining tracking accuracy in challenging scenarios where targets are partially or fully obscured. By leveraging Gaussian mixture models, Kumar’s method effectively distinguishes between target and background appearances, enabling more reliable performance in real-world applications such as surveillance and autonomous systems. Although his citation count is currently modest, his contributions address a critical bottleneck in visual tracking—occlusion—which remains an active area of research. Kumar’s work demonstrates a strong foundation in probabilistic modeling and its practical deployment for dynamic environments.
